Put mushrooms in a saucepan and cover with water. Bring to a boil and simmer for 5 minutes. Pack hot into hot jars, leaving 1-inch head space. Add ½ teaspoon salt per pint if desired or ¼ teaspoon per half-pint. For better color, add ⅛ teaspoon of crystalline ascorbic acid powder or a 500-milligram tablet of vitamin C.

Place mushrooms in a large pot of water and bring it to a boil over medium-high heat. Boil mushrooms for 5 minutes. Ladle hot mushrooms and the canning liquid into pint or half-pint jars leaving 1" of headspace. Place 1/2 teaspoon of salt in each pint or 1/4 teaspoon of salt in each half-pint if desired. Remove any bubbles with a bubble remover.

Leave small mushrooms whole; cut large ones. Cover with water in a saucepan and boil 5 minutes. Fill jars with hot mushrooms, leaving 1-inch headspace. Add 1/2 teaspoon of salt per pint to the jar, if desired. For better color, add 1/8 teaspoon of ascorbic acid powder, or a 500-milligram tablet of vitamin C. Add fresh hot water, leaving 1-inch.

Fill all the jars leaving 1" headspace. Add 1/2 teaspoon of salt per pint to the jar, if desired. For better color, add 1/8 teaspoon of ascorbic acid powder, or a 500-milligram tablet of vitamin C. Add fresh hot water, leaving 1- inch headspace. Remove air bubbles with your rubber spatula or chopsticks and refill if necessary.
